soundstation
yesterday, the absolute realest shop in my hometown burned down. bob and liz sold me tons of cds and got me into a lot of new music throughout my childhood and high school years. its seriously such a bummer to know that future generations of kids growing up in new jersey might not be able to have this shop. if you have ever been to soundstation or just want to show some respect for local business run by genuine people doing what they love, please donate anything you can to help get these guys back on their feet.
